Reporting to the Director of Publications, your primary role will be to redraw and illustrate basic and conceptual figures to a standard style for the Society’s journals and books, proactively liaising with copyeditors and authors to ensure quality and accuracy. You will also be involved in maintaining the publications’ websites using a CMS and basic HTML, and ensuring online adverts are hosted to clients’ requirements. Other duties will include ensuring the quality of figures redrawn by an external supplier; designing publication covers and layout templates; designing static adverts for online and print usage; manipulating files to output for online or print use; and ad hoc layout/typesetting of publications in InDesign.
The position is permanent and part-time (80%), based in the office in Sheffield. Due to the pandemic, home working is currently in operation, and when the office reopens a mix of home/office working is envisioned.
